Inattentive-impulsive ADHD

When people hear ADHD the first thought might be of a young child. The disorder can also affect adults. This is why it is difficult to recognize and diagnose.

A person should have at least five signs that affect their daily life to be diagnosed with ADHD. They also need to be present in more than one place.

A person with inattentive-impulsive ADHD will often be forgetful and lack concentration. This can lead to careless mistakes, as well as other issues.

These symptoms can interfere with social interaction and academic performance. They can also create emotional problems. The patient may act impulsively disrupting others and taking crucial decisions without considering the consequences.

Adults with inattentive-impulsive ADHD may feel a sense of restlessness and frustration. These symptoms can impact their ability to complete assignments at school or at work or return phone calls or send birthday cards on time, and pay for bills.

Inattentive-impulsive ADHD can be difficult to diagnose. The disorder can lead to children and adolescents taking over the tasks of others. Some symptoms are similar to other mental disorders.

Inattentive-impulsive types of ADHD are generally less common than hyperactive types. It is more likely to affect girls than boys.

Many people suffering from this disorder are easily distracted by other stimuli. They might not finish their work are distracted, make mistakes, forget to drink or eat, or even sleep.

Hyperactivity

Adult ADHD symptoms include hyperactivity, inattention, and impulsiveness. These symptoms can interfere with the quality of work and social life. They can be a contributing factor to addiction and low self-esteem.

Many adults don't realize they are suffering from ADHD until it is too late. The disorder affects more than 10 million Americans, including teenagers and children.

Although the condition isn't completely preventable, it is able to be treated. Cognitive behavioral therapy can help people improve their focus and control their impulses. Cognitive behavioral therapy can help people improve their time management and organizational skills.

A precise diagnosis of adult ADHD requires a thorough clinical evaluation. This includes a thorough examination of the symptoms as well as an examination of the person's previous, emotional, and physical health issues. A doctor could recommend the person to the services of a coach or mental health professional.

Talking to an experienced doctor about ADHD will require you to explain your symptoms. Your doctor will check you to determine whether you have any other medical issues like depression or anxiety. Your doctor may ask you to disclose any previous relationships that have caused problems.

ADHD medication adverse effects

Treatments for adults suffering from ADHD symptoms are often used to improve behavior and attention. The potential for side effects is. The side effects vary depending on the medication as well as the individual reaction to the medication.

One common side effect of medications for adults with ADHD symptoms is an occasional increase in blood pressure. Fortunately, the increase is usually not significant. It is also possible to decrease it by changing the timing or dosage of the medication.

If a medication prescribed for adults with ADHD symptoms causes adverse consequences, it's crucial to discuss them with your physician. They may modify the dosage or suggest a different form of medication.

The side effects of medication for ADHD symptoms include anxiety, sweating, depression, and anxiety. As with other medical conditions, it's crucial to be aware of the potential side effects and to consult with your health care provider to determine a treatment strategy.
